How the figures are made
Whose games these are
11K+ rated games played on Lichess (2023-12 to 2025-11). The games are Lichess’s and free for anyone to use. What is ours is the reading of them. Last rebuilt January 2026.
Which games we count
  • Rated games only — nothing casual.
  • Both players within 200 rating points of each other. A mismatch tells you about the gap, not about the opening.
  • At least 2 moves played.
  • A game is filed under White’s rating.
Why every number comes with a range
A number off a few hundred games is a guess. The same number off millions is a fact. The range is what tells them apart, and it is what the lists rank on — so an opening cannot reach the top on a lucky run of forty games. The more games behind a figure, the narrower its range.
How much we need before we say anything
An opening page needs 100 games. A gambit needs 50 games at a rating before we will say whether it pays there. The chaos and trap lists need 500 games overall and 250 games at one rating or clock.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the King's Indian Defense: Sämisch Variation, Panno Formation win rate?

Playing the King's Indian Defense: Sämisch Variation, Panno Formation, Black wins 47.8%, draws 5.5% and loses 46.7%. Counting a draw as half a point, that is an Expected Score of 50.6%. It rests on 11K rated games from Lichess.

At what rating does the King's Indian Defense: Sämisch Variation, Panno Formation perform best?

The King's Indian Defense: Sämisch Variation, Panno Formation performs best for Black at 2000-2199, with an Expected Score of 53.1% (3.0K games) and the highest Floor of any rating with enough games to read.

Is the King's Indian Defense: Sämisch Variation, Panno Formation better in blitz or rapid?

For Black, the King's Indian Defense: Sämisch Variation, Panno Formation scores higher in Rapid: an Expected Score of 50.7% in Blitz (7.3K games) against 52.5% in Rapid (600 games).

How sharp is the King's Indian Defense: Sämisch Variation, Panno Formation?

The King's Indian Defense: Sämisch Variation, Panno Formation has a sharpness score of 94.5 (decisive), meaning 94.5% of games end decisively. Average game length is 38 moves.
